Inigo_Montoyastarted grow question 7y
My question is will there be pollen remaining in the grow room after a self pollenating auto is removed. Will it effect the next grow?
Solved
Techniques. Defoliation
likes
Stick
Stickanswered grow question 7y
Hi @Inigo_Montoya! Well, pollen is like dust, it's able to fly everywhere, hide in discreet places, and move in the air. In your scenario, I would triple-clean the grow room, using a vacuum-cleaner then white vinegar then soap mixed with neem oil. The vacuum-cleaner will help to get rid of the pollen left in the room, the vinegar will sterilize your environment and kill every living bacterias, and the soap+neem oil solution will help to prevent bugs from invading your garden for a while. Hope this will help, keep us up-to-date and happy growing 👊

Stealthgardner
What are your container size and what are you using for light?
Inigo_Montoya
Inigo_Montoyacommented7y
@Stealthgardner, Eight bulb, four foot t5's, four veg. and four bloom, 24/7. Drilled holes in the bottom and sides of a 2-1/2 gal. plastic wastebasket from the Dollar store. Medium was potting soil with 30% perlite mixed in.
